Recommendations for integrating route optimization?

My data includes locations, so given several of those locations, I want to know what's the best way to determine the most optimal route between them. Is there a way to do this with the Google Map extension in QlikView, or is this best done outside of QlikView? Suggestions much appreciated!

Hi Lan,

I have worked a little bit with route optimization before and it's hard to say without knowing the complexity of your data set.

Google does it ok for ground based routes but that's about it. If by optimal you mean going from point A to the next location in terms of distance then yes Google might be a viable alternative. QlikView could easily just sort the lat and long values to determine that for you and then let google handle the transit paths.

Usually with the more advanced data sets you would calculate the optimal route based on several variables in a external route optimization tool and then use that optimized data set to visualize in QlikView. For example you would need to take into account stock inventory, warehouse placement, how to load your truck etc etc.
